Hello,大家好,今天跟大家分享下如何在Excel实现根据关键字来对数据进行求和与计数,工作中遇到这样的问题,大多数需要对某一类数据进行统计。很多人遇到这样的问题,都是将具有关键字的数据一个一个地筛选出来然后再统计,非常的耗费时间,其实我们利用一个*号就能轻松搞定,下面就让我们来看下它是如何操作的吧
专栏30天excel从入门到精通作者:Excel从零到一29.9币2,817人已购查看一、了解通配符
所谓的通配符其实就是一个符号,只不过这个符号可以表示所有字符,可以是汉字,可以是数字,可以是字母等等,只需要是你能在Excel单元格中输入的通配符都可以表示,我们常用的通配符有2个
?:可以代表任意单个字符
*:可以代表任意多个字符
这两个通配符它是的区别只有一个,就是字符多少的区域。问号(?)这个通配符表示仅仅只有1个字符,星号(*)他可以代表没有字符,也可以代表有无穷多个字符
以上就是有关通配符的知识,下面就让我们来看下如何使用通配符解决根据关键字求和的问题
二、根据关键字求和
如下图,我们需要求车间总和,其实他还是一个条件求和的问题,在众多部门中找出车间的所有部门将其求和,现在我们知道了通配符,就可以使用通配符来构建sumif函数的求和条件,只需要将公式设置为:=SUMIF($A$1:$A$15,"*车间",$B$1:$B$15)即可求得所有的车间之和
来简单地讲解下这个函数,公式为:=SUMIF($A$1:$A$15,"*车间",$B$1:$B$15)
第一参数:$A$1:$A$15,用于条件区域第二参数:"*车间",代表所有的车间,因为在这里车间两个字都在最后面,我们可以将条件设置为*车间第三参数:$B$1:$B$15,用于求和的数据区域
在这里需要注意的是第一参数与第三参数的数据必须一一对应,单元格的引用方式也最好选择绝对引用。
想要根据关键字在计数的话,方法是一样的,比如在这里我们想要统计下车间的人数,只需要将公式设置为:=COUNTIF($A$2:$A$15,"*车间")即可
最后给大家留一个小问题:因为车间两个字都在部门的最后我们可以用*车间来代表所有的车间,如果车间两个字不全在最后面,那么这个式子该怎么写呢?
以上就是今天分享的方法,你学会了吗?
我是Excel从零到一,我,持续分享更多Excel技巧
(此处已添加圈子卡片,请到今日头条客户端查看)